A survey of data mining in cloud computing
Authors
Chanda Monga, Minakshi Sharma, Etti Sharma
Abstract
Data Mining is the development of raw data in to potentially useful information. So It is considered an important process for finding new, valid, useful and understandable forms of data. Cloud Computing gives the new development in internet services that rely on clouds of servers for handling the tasks. Cloud computing is a inventive technology that can support a large range of applications. Cloud computing is basically providing software, platform and infrastructure as a service over the internet and every customer can access these software, platforms and infrastructure from a remote area. With the rapid development of internet and raise in commerce allows the companies to protect, store, retrieve and analysis of their important data through cloud services with data mining. When the concept of Data mining is used in cloud computing then extraction of structured information from unstructured or semi-structured web data sources is done.
